Product
Pricing
arrow
Get Proxies
arrow
Use Cases
arrow
Locations
arrow
Help Center
arrow
Program
arrow
Email
Enterprise Service
menu
Email
Enterprise Service
Submit
Basic information
Waiting for a reply
Your form has been submitted. We'll contact you in 24 hours.
Close
Home/ Blog/ How does an HTTPS proxy ensure security in terms of data encryption?

How does an HTTPS proxy ensure security in terms of data encryption?

PYPROXY PYPROXY · Jun 05, 2025

In today’s digital age, the importance of online security cannot be overstated. With the increasing reliance on the internet for daily activities, securing sensitive data during transmission has become a critical concern. One of the most effective ways to ensure the safety of data is by using HTTPS proxies. These proxies provide a secure, encrypted channel between a client and the web server, preventing unauthorized access, man-in-the-middle attacks, and data tampering. In this article, we will delve into the mechanisms through which HTTPS proxies ensure data encryption security, their advantages, and how they contribute to a safer online experience for users.

Understanding HTTPS Proxies and Their Role in Data Encryption

Before we explore how HTTPS proxies secure data, it is essential to understand what an HTTPS proxy is. HTTPS (Hypertext Transfer Protocol Secure) proxies act as intermediaries between a client (usually a browser) and the server it wants to communicate with. These proxies route the traffic securely using the SSL/TLS protocols to ensure that the data exchanged is encrypted.

The primary role of an HTTPS proxy is to establish a secure tunnel for communication between the client and the destination server. This means that any data exchanged, such as login credentials, financial information, or personal details, is transmitted in an encrypted format, preventing it from being intercepted or altered during transit.

How HTTPS Encryption Works: SSL/TLS Protocols

The core of HTTPS encryption lies in SSL (Secure Sockets Layer) and TLS (Transport Layer Security) protocols. When a client requests a secure connection, the proxy server initiates a handshake process, establishing a secure channel. Here’s a step-by-step breakdown of the encryption process:

1. Handshake Initiation: The client sends a request to the proxy server, and the server responds with a digital certificate. This certificate contains a public key that helps initiate the encryption process.

2. Key Exchange: Using asymmetric encryption, the client and proxy server exchange keys. The client uses the proxy's public key to encrypt a shared secret, which only the proxy can decrypt with its private key.

3. Session Key Generation: After the key exchange, both the client and the proxy generate a session key that will be used for symmetric encryption during the session. This session key is faster and more efficient than asymmetric encryption for ongoing communication.

4. Data Transmission: All subsequent data exchanged between the client and the server is encrypted using the session key, ensuring that even if the data is intercepted, it cannot be decrypted without the key.

5. Session Termination: Once the session ends, the session key is discarded, making the communication secure and non-reusable for future sessions.

By utilizing SSL/TLS protocols, HTTPS proxies protect the integrity and confidentiality of the data, ensuring that attackers cannot eavesdrop or alter the information.

Benefits of HTTPS Proxies in Data Encryption

The adoption of HTTPS proxies brings several notable benefits in enhancing data security:

1. End-to-End Encryption: HTTPS proxies provide end-to-end encryption, meaning the data remains encrypted from the client to the destination server. This prevents third-party entities, such as hackers or malicious actors, from accessing sensitive data during transmission.

2. Prevention of Man-in-the-Middle (MITM) Attacks: Man-in-the-middle attacks occur when attackers intercept communication between the client and server, potentially modifying the data. HTTPS proxies mitigate this risk by encrypting the entire communication channel, ensuring that attackers cannot tamper with the data.

3. Secure Authentication: HTTPS proxies rely on digital certificates to authenticate servers, ensuring that clients are connecting to the correct server. This prevents phishing and ensures that the client’s data is only sent to trusted sources.

4. Data Integrity: In addition to confidentiality, HTTPS proxies ensure data integrity by using cryptographic hash functions. This guarantees that the data has not been altered during transmission.

5. Encryption Against Local Threats: While local threats such as malware and spyware may still pose risks to data security, HTTPS proxies can offer an additional layer of encryption, especially in public or unsecured networks like Wi-Fi hotspots.

Challenges and Limitations of HTTPS Proxies

Despite the robust security features of HTTPS proxies, there are some challenges and limitations to consider:

1. Performance Overhead: The encryption and decryption processes can introduce some latency and computational overhead, which may affect browsing speeds. However, modern hardware and optimized encryption algorithms have mitigated this issue significantly.

2. SSL/TLS Vulnerabilities: While SSL/TLS protocols are generally secure, certain vulnerabilities, such as those found in older versions of SSL, may expose communication to risks. It is crucial to regularly update encryption protocols to ensure maximum security.

3. Proxy Server Trustworthiness: The security of HTTPS proxies largely depends on the trustworthiness of the proxy provider. If the proxy server is compromised, it could potentially decrypt and access the data being transmitted. It’s essential to choose reputable proxy providers that adhere to strict security standards.

4. Difficulties in Scalability: For large enterprises or systems with high traffic volumes, scaling the use of HTTPS proxies might require significant resources. Handling a high volume of encrypted connections can strain server resources, necessitating high-performance infrastructure.

Why Businesses Should Implement HTTPS Proxies

For businesses that handle sensitive data, implementing HTTPS proxies is essential for maintaining a secure online presence. Here are a few reasons why:

1. Regulatory Compliance: Many industries, such as finance and healthcare, are governed by strict data protection regulations. Implementing HTTPS proxies ensures compliance with these regulations, protecting both customer data and the business’s reputation.

2. Customer Trust: Customers are becoming increasingly aware of data security. Using HTTPS proxies to protect their data not only provides a secure experience but also enhances the business’s reputation and trustworthiness.

3. Protection of Intellectual Property: For businesses that deal with proprietary information, protecting intellectual property during transmission is crucial. HTTPS proxies ensure that sensitive data is kept confidential, preventing unauthorized access or theft.

In conclusion, HTTPS proxies play a vital role in securing data during transmission, offering a secure and encrypted communication channel between clients and web servers. By utilizing SSL/TLS protocols, HTTPS proxies ensure that data remains confidential, integral, and protected from external threats. Although there are some challenges associated with HTTPS proxies, the benefits far outweigh the drawbacks, especially for businesses that prioritize data security and customer trust. As cyber threats continue to evolve, HTTPS proxies will remain an essential tool in safeguarding online communication.

Related Posts

Clicky